Episode Summary:
In this episode of Chamber Amplified from the Findlay-Hancock County Chamber of Commerce, host Doug Jenkins digs into the heart of community building with Stacy Shaw of Children's Mentoring Connection (CMC). As they celebrate an impressive 50-year legacy, Stacy offers a deep-dive into the organization's evolution, the significance of mentorship, and the strategies employed to navigate fundraising during challenging times.
The conversation centers around the essential need for mentorship in the Hancock County area, detailing how mentors of all ages can have a substantial impact on local youth. Stacy underscores the uniqueness of high school mentors interacting with younger children, realizing the potential of mentoring to influence both academic and extracurricular interests positively. Beyond discussing mentoring benefits, the episode also delves into the organization's adaptive strategies during the COVID-19 pandemic, particularly focusing on their creative approach to maintaining their signature fundraiser event, Bowl for Kids.
Key Takeaways:

  • Children's Mentoring Connection has contributed to Hancock County for 50 years, originally starting as Big Brothers Big Sisters before transforming into CMC.
  • A significant need exists for mentors in the local community, and individuals from varied walks of life, including high school students, make effective mentors.
  • Mentoring not only benefits the children but also fosters empathy and perspective among the high school students who serve as mentors.
  • The annual Bowl for Kids is CMC's signature fundraising event, critical in sustaining their initiatives at no cost to families or schools.
  • CMC showcased flexibility in face of the pandemic by reinventing their fundraising event to include at-home versions like cornhole tournaments, thus maintaining community involvement.
